Output 59f968899716561a97c68c2a06fe667fba9db581af89a41f623d6dbdb0fa4092:1

value
5209311077
script pubkey
OP_0 OP_PUSHBYTES_20 3084ab32f66edc4bf1650dae9ed74a6910fa31f6
address
tb1qxzz2kvhkdmwyhut9pkhfa462dyg05v0kdmeksh
transaction
59f968899716561a97c68c2a06fe667fba9db581af89a41f623d6dbdb0fa4092